LanguaL

The foods in Matvaretabellen are described using a classification system called LanguaL. LanguaL stands for "Langua aLimentaria" or "language of food". This language enables standardized descriptions of foods.

MI0120

Salt equivalent calculated from sodium (NACL[g]=2.5*NA[mg]/1000.0)

MI0142

Water by difference (WATER[g] = 100 - PROT[g] - FAT[g] - CHO[g] - FIBT[g] - ALC[g])

MI0181

Carbohydrate, available calculated from sugar and starch (CHO[g] = SUGAR[g] + STARCH[g])

MI0322

Vitamin A activity calculated from retinol and beta-carotene (factor 1/6) (VITA[µg] = RETOL[µg] + (CARTB[µg] / 6))

MI0325

Vitamin A activity calculated from retinol and beta-carotene (factor 1/12) (VITA[µg] = RETOL[µg] + (CARTB[µg] / 12))

MI0421

Niacin equivalents calculated from niacin and tryptophan (NIAEQ[mg] = NIA[mg] + TRP[mg] / 60)

MI_SUGAR_NO

Sugar calculated as the sum of fructose, glucose, lactose, maltose and sucrose (SUGAR[g] = FRUS[g] + GLUS[g] + LACS[g] + MALS[g] + SUCS[g])
